A small shelter for delicate plants is to be constructed of thin plastic material. It will have a square end and a rectangular t

op and back, with an open bottom and front as shown in the figure. The total are of the four plastic sides is to be 1200in^2.
a) Express the volume of the shelter as a function of the depth x.
b) What dimensions will maximize the volume of the shelter?

Part A

The four plastic sides comprises of two equal squares of area x^{2} each and two equal rectangles of area xy each.

Given that t<span>he total area of the four plastic sides is to be 1200in^2, thus:

2x^2+2xy=1200 \\  \\ \Rightarrow x^2+xy=600 \\  \\ \Rightarrow xy=600-x^2

The volume of the figure is given by: Volume = Area of base x depth

V=(xy)x=x(600-x^2)=600x-x^3



Part B:

For maximum volume, the derivative of V with respect to x will equal 0.

\frac{dV}{dx} =0 \\  \\ \Rightarrow600-3x^2=0 \\  \\ \Rightarrow3x^2=600 \\  \\ \Rightarrow x^2=200 \\  \\ \Rightarrow x=\pm \sqrt{200} =\pm14.14

But dimensions has to be positive, thus the value of x which produces maximum volume is x = 14.14

Recall that

xy=600-x \\  \\ \Rightarrow y= \frac{600}{x} -x \\  \\ = \frac{600}{14.14} -14.14 \\  \\ =42.43-14.14 \\  \\ =28.29

Therefore, the </span><span>dimensions that will maximize the volume of the shelter is x = 14.14 and y = 28.29</span>
